L- Dark blood red body, filtered. Small tan head, low persistence.
S- Strong raisins, some caramel malts and toasted grains.
T- Raisins, sugar and roasted malts. Leaves a moderate warm roasted aftertaste.
F- Slightly watery.
O- Very good amber ale, but loses its punch towards the end.
